Bryce Harper Up in 2012??
Thomas Boswell, Washington PostThe Nats' decision to make a major free agent splash this winter, rather than next, is probably connected to Harper's strong showing in the Arizona Fall League. Only the rare Mickey Mantle or Ken Griffey Jr., has proved to be big league ready at age 19. But the Nats have opened the door for the possibility.
Wow. I had the thought that Harper would be up in mid-2012, but this leads me to believe that he could start the season in Washington, and possibly in centerfield.
